My free trial expired and a deployment I'd initiated during that window failed. I upgraded to the Hobby plan and triggered a redeploy. The dashboard shows "Hobby" as my current plan and current usage as $0, but the deployment crash-loops immediately on every container start with:

fatal: Your account or project has exceeded the compute time quota.

Upgrade your plan to increase limits.

This repeats every 1-2 seconds (container starts, hits the error, dies, restarts) - the service never actually comes up. Given the plan shows Hobby and usage shows $0, this looks like a stale quota flag from the trial period that hasn't cleared after the upgrade, rather than a genuine limit being hit.

Could there be a leftover quota restriction from the trial that needs clearing manually, or is there's anything on my end I should also check or change?

Thank you for clarifying! That log line is coming from your application itself, not from Railway. What app are you running?

You're right, looks like it's coming from Neon (my Postgres provider), not my application itself - it's their own "compute time quota exceeded" message surfacing through the DB connection on startup. Not a Railway issue after all, I'll follow up with Neon directly. Appreciate you looking into it.
